I was raised going to church, but when I moved away from my family, I didn’t want to go. I didn’t know anyone and the churches I visited seemed unfriendly. But I knew it was something that needed it – food for my soul. So I found a friend who was also looking for a church, and we stuck it out visiting different churches until I found one I liked. The second step is having the guts to stick around until you get to know people. Relationships is the key to going to church. Once I made a few friends, it was easy to keep attending. I am so glad I put in the effort.
